What happens to your answers?

Your views matter. Your feedback gives us, postgraduate deans and royal colleges, vital evidence on the support, time and resources you need to train others.

Your answers help:

  • postgraduate deans to address local concerns and examples of good practice.
  • your college and faculty to review curricula and how specialties are taught
  • policy makers and health services across the UK to identify trends and take action where improvements are needed.
  • regulators and quality improvement bodies to resolve patient safety issues
  • us - the GMC - to identify serious concerns, and work with postgraduate deans to address them. We also use the data to speak up about the pressures and challenges you’re facing.
  • provide a regular source of data on a number of areas important for delivering high-quality education, such as:
    • recognition of the importance of the trainer role through appraisal
    • time for training
    • professional development in the trainer role.
